Abstract

Multiprocessor machines provide increased computational power and memory capacity that can be used to achieve task involving large amount of data such as image. For instance, many sophisticated operations on image data using a single processor machine take very long time. With multiprocessor machine, such operations will be accomplished within reasonable time constraints. In order to efficiently utilize multiprocessor machines, conventional image processing algorithms have to be parallelized.
